Meme Coins Moon as Traditional Tokens Tumble

This week in crypto takes a turn for the wild. Meme coins are back with a vengeance and leading the charge in market gains. Meanwhile, conventional and gold-pegged digital assets are fading into the background. Add Twitter-fueled AI fantasies and Solana NFT buzz, and you’ve got a true blockchain circus. Here’s what went down.

Top-performing meme tokens BRETT (+39.12%), PNUT (+33.33%), and PENGU (+32.27%) highlight a sharp pivot in market sentiment toward speculative assets. At the same time, institutional and gold-linked cryptos like LAYER (-28.2%) and PAXG (-2.14%) are slipping. Crypto Twitter is buzzing with AI-DeFi mashups and Solana NFT excitement, reinforcing the narrative-driven volatility we’ve come to expect in Q2.

The Meme Coin Comeback Is Real

In the ever-whirling carousel that is crypto, this week saw a playful yet potent shift. Meme coins, those satirical assets that once felt like the Internet’s inside joke, have returned with serious firepower. Leading the charge: BRETT, clocking in an almost unbelievable 39.12% gain over the last 24 hours. BRETT, the cheeky token loosely associated with Matt Furie’s Pepe universe, seems to be reaping the benefits of renewed interest in on-chain culture and niche community cohesion.

Next in line, PNUT and PENGU—both carrying that distinct meme-coin flavor—logged gains of 33.33% and 32.27% respectively. Social analytics platforms like LunarCrush confirm a 200% increase in Twitter mentions for these tokens, hinting at a sudden flood of retail attention. Meanwhile, VIRTUAL (up 32.85%) and SAFE (up 28.33%) also cashed in on the momentum, possibly benefiting from broader narratives around Web3 gaming and decentralized asset custody.

Classic Crypto Assets Go Cold

While meme coins moon, traditional and gold-linked crypto assets head in the opposite direction. Most notably, LAYER nose-dived 28.2%, the worst performer among major tokens in the last 24 hours. The decline follows news of delays in LAYER's roadmap updates, which has irked some of the institutionally-minded investors betting on its modular blockchain thesis.

The dour mood smeared across BORG (-6.40%) and VENOM (-6.03%), two projects that had been darlings of recent Layer 1 speculation. Surprisingly, even stable stores of value like Paxos Gold (PAXG) and Tether Gold (XAUT) edged down slightly, by -2.14% and -2.10% respectively. A rare move, and perhaps a sentiment signal—investors appear to be stepping away from ‘safe haven’ crypto plays in search of volatility (and maybe memes).

Crypto Twitter: Full of Frogs and AI Fantasies

If you’re wondering what’s fueling this week’s meme coin euphoria, just scroll through Crypto Twitter for 30 seconds. It’s flooded with animated GIFs, pixel art memes, culture wars, and yes—AI speculation.

One of the hottest narratives floating through the Twitter-sphere involves the crossover between artificial intelligence and decentralized protocols. Influencers like @CryptoChadGPT and @LayerZilla are pushing the idea of “autonomous trading agents” powered by LLMs connected to DeFi rails. That may still be a moonshot, but the hype is influencing bags today—particularly VIRTUAL, which some speculate may pivot into an AI collaboration with a major gaming metaverse.

Another surprising trend? The resurgence of Solana NFTs. Hashtags like #SolanaSummer and #PENGU are gaining steam again, especially following announcements from key Solana devs teasing upcoming NFT infra upgrades. For those deep in the weeds, this could be fueling risk-on tilt toward Solana-native meme coins like PENGU.

What’s the Vibe? Retail Risk-On, Institutions Hedged Out

We’re seeing a divergence in market appetite. Retail traders appear to be rotating into higher volatility plays—meme coins, culture tokens, and narrative-driven midcaps. In contrast, the relative underperformance of institutional-leaning assets like LAYER and the gold-backed cryptos suggests those with a cautious long-term outlook are sitting on the sidelines. This bifurcation often precedes short-term rallies but can also signal volatility ahead.

In a nutshell: degens are jockeying for yield in viral assets, while conservative capital waits for clearer macro signs—and possibly, regulation.

Volatility as a Feature, Not a Bug

The crypto market’s dual-personality disorder continues to offer alpha for those watching the ebbs and flows of digital crowd psychology. While Bitcoin and Ethereum remain relatively flat on the week, activity in the altcoin trenches is booming.

In fact, according to on-chain transfer data, wallet activity for meme tokens has spiked by over 300%. That’s not noise—it’s signal. More wallets, more transactions, more chatter—it all points to inflows into high-risk, high-reward acquisition plans. Whether this leads to another parabolic cycle or a swift correction is TBD. But for now, traders are betting big on vibes.
